Obat builds invoicing and project-management software for construction artisans and contractors in France. The tech stack reveals a deliberate modernization in progress: legacy PHP/Symfony monolith (MySQL, MongoDB) paired with contemporary frontend (React, TypeScript) and distributed backend patterns (microfrontends, BFF, monorepo). Active projects around n8n workflow automation and custom integrations (Python, Node.js) suggest the core product is shifting from pure billing toward operational workflow orchestration—addressing the pain point of reducing administrative time for field teams.
Obat is a French SaaS platform founded in 2019 that provides invoicing, quote management, and project-tracking tools for construction businesses, from solo artisans to small contracting firms. The product is built on PHP/Symfony with a modern React frontend, deployed on AWS. Beyond invoicing mechanics, the platform integrates with accounting systems and jobsite management workflows. The current engineering-and-data-focused hiring mix (3 engineers, 2 data, 1 product across 51–200 employees) reflects an organizational phase centered on product scaling and internal tooling, not sales expansion. The company operates entirely within France.
Obat's core stack is PHP/Symfony and MySQL on the backend, React and TypeScript on frontend, with MongoDB for document storage. AWS X-Ray handles observability. For automation and integrations, the platform uses n8n, Python, and Node.js.
Current projects include microfrontend and BFF architecture, monorepo restructuring, n8n workflow automation, Python/Node.js custom integrations, and ETL/data warehouse optimization—indicating a shift toward operational automation beyond core invoicing.
Other companies in the same industry, closest in size